My Cart: 0 item(s)

Product Search (fasten header using Searchspring)

Email us for quick support
Click to text us! 616-796-6638 Aftermarket Parts for All Brands: hyster, yale, toyota, and more!
ARE YOU IN CANADA? Click Here  |  HABLAMOS ESPAÑOL Click Aqui
0
OPEN 8-6 EST M-F
Search for any product on our site

Secure Checkout

Theory Of Computation By Vivek Kulkarni Pdf ((install)) Free Download May 2026

Navigating the Theory of Computation with Vivek Kulkarni If you are a Computer Science student or a professional looking to master the backbone of modern computing, Theory of Computation by Vivek Kulkarni is a cornerstone resource. Published by Oxford University Press

, this 560-page textbook is widely recognized for its student-friendly approach to complex mathematical concepts. Why This Book Stands Out Vivek Kulkarni, a Principal Architect at Persistent Systems

with over 18 years of experience, wrote this book specifically to address the lack of approachable materials for undergraduate students. Key highlights include: Persistent Systems Algorithmic Focus

: Procedures are presented in algorithmic form, making them easy to implement in any programming language. Comprehensive Pedagogy

: Includes numerous solved examples, flowcharts, and exercises graded by Bloom's taxonomy principles. Implementation Details

: Appendices provide 'C' source code for key algorithms discussed throughout the text. Oxford University Press Core Topics Covered

The text provides a logical progression from fundamental concepts to advanced computational models: Foundations : Symbols, alphabets, sets, relations, and graphs. Automata Theory

: In-depth coverage of Finite State Machines (FSM), Regular Expressions, and Grammars. Computational Models

: Detailed exploration of Pushdown Stacks, Turing Machines, and Post Machines. Advanced Logic

: Unique chapters on production systems, including Markov and Labelled Markov algorithms. Complexity

: Decidability, undecidability, and the complexity of problems. Understanding "Free Download" Options

While many students search for a "Theory of Computation by Vivek Kulkarni PDF free download," it is important to note that this is a copyrighted academic work. Legal Access : The book is commercially available through retailers like Official Samples

: Educational platforms often host authorized excerpts or solutions. For instance, some chapter solutions and review question manuals are available via the author's WordPress blog Library Access

: Students can often find digital copies through university library systems or platforms like Google Books for preview. Google Books

Supporting authors by purchasing or using official library channels ensures the continued production of high-quality educational content. specific chapters to help with your current coursework, or would you like a comparison with other classic TOC textbooks like Sipser or Ullman?

Theory of Computation - Vivek Kulkarni - Oxford University Press

I can’t help locate or provide pirated copies of copyrighted books. If you want lawful access to "Theory of Computation" by Vivek Kulkarni, here are legal options you can use:

Related search suggestions (terms you can try): "Vivek Kulkarni Theory of Computation textbook", "Theory of Computation pdf legal download", "Vivek Kulkarni lecture notes automata theory".

The textbook " Theory of Computation" by Vivek Kulkarni , published by Oxford University Press (OUP), is a highly regarded resource for undergraduate students in Computer Science and Engineering.

While you may find links to unofficial PDF copies on platforms like Scribd or Studocu, these are often user-uploaded and may not be authorised by the publisher. To support the author and ensure you have the most accurate, complete version, it is recommended to use official channels. Key Highlights of the Book

Vivek Kulkarni, a Principal Architect at Persistent Systems, wrote this book to make complex computational theories more accessible for beginners.

Comprehensive Pedagogy: Features plenty of solved examples, figures, notes, and flowcharts to simplify difficult proofs. Theory Of Computation By Vivek Kulkarni Pdf Free Download

Algorithmic Approach: Every procedure is presented in algorithmic form, allowing students to implement them in any programming language.

C Implementation: Includes a dedicated chapter with C source code for key algorithms related to regular languages.

Exam Readiness: Includes numerous objective-type questions and model papers specifically designed for university examinations. Table of Contents

The book follows a logical progression through the foundations of computer science:

Preliminaries: Sets, relations, graphs, and mathematical induction. Finite State Machines: DFA, NFA, Moore and Mealy machines.

Regular Expressions: Equivalence with finite automata and Pumping Lemma.

Turing Machines: Formalism, halting problem, and Church-Turing hypothesis.

Grammars: Context-free languages (CFLs), Normal forms (CNF/GNF), and Chomsky Hierarchy.

Pushdown Automata (PDA): Acceptance of CFLs and equivalence with grammars.

Advanced Topics: Parsing techniques, Post machines, Undecidability, and Complexity classes (P and NP). Official Purchase Options

The book is widely available in both digital and physical formats:

Theory of Computation - Vivek Kulkarni - Oxford University Press

Theory of Computation by Vivek Kulkarni PDF Free Download

The "Theory of Computation" is a fundamental subject in Computer Science that deals with the study of algorithms, automata, and formal languages. For students and professionals looking to gain a deeper understanding of this subject, "Theory of Computation" by Vivek Kulkarni is a highly recommended textbook.

About the Book

" Theory of Computation" by Vivek Kulkarni is a comprehensive textbook that covers the core concepts of the subject, including automata theory, computability, and complexity theory. The book provides a detailed analysis of the theoretical foundations of computer science, making it an ideal resource for students, researchers, and professionals in the field.

Why Download the PDF?

Downloading the PDF version of "Theory of Computation" by Vivek Kulkarni can be highly beneficial for students and enthusiasts who want to explore the subject in-depth. Some of the advantages of having a digital copy of the book include:

Where to Download the PDF?

There are several websites and online platforms that offer free downloads of "Theory of Computation" by Vivek Kulkarni in PDF format. However, it is essential to ensure that the website or platform is reputable and legitimate to avoid any potential risks or malware.

Alternative Options

For those who prefer not to download a PDF copy, "Theory of Computation" by Vivek Kulkarni is also available in print and e-book formats on various online marketplaces, such as Amazon and Google Books.

Conclusion

In conclusion, "Theory of Computation" by Vivek Kulkarni is an excellent resource for anyone interested in gaining a deeper understanding of the theoretical foundations of computer science. Downloading a free PDF copy of the book can be a convenient and cost-effective way to access the material, but it is essential to ensure that the source is legitimate and reputable. Whether you're a student, researcher, or professional, this book is an invaluable resource that can help you develop a strong foundation in the subject.

Theory of Computation by Vivek Kulkarni, published by Oxford University Press, is a widely recognized textbook for undergraduate students in Computer Science and Information Technology. Core Content & Structure

The book is structured to guide students from foundational mathematical concepts to complex computational models.

Foundations: Covers preliminaries like symbols, alphabets, sets, relations, and graphs.

Machine Models: Dedicated chapters explore Finite State Machines, Pushdown Automata, and Turing Machines.

Languages & Grammars: Detailed sections on Regular Expressions, Context-Free Grammars, and parsing techniques.

Advanced Topics: Unique inclusion of Post Machines and Production Systems (Markov and labeled Markov algorithms), which offer alternatives to the standard Turing model.

Theoretical Limits: Addresses Undecidability and the Complexity of problems. Key Features for Students

Algorithmic Approach: Procedures are presented in algorithmic form, allowing readers to implement them in any programming language of their choice.

Practical Implementation: The book includes an appendix with C source codes for key algorithms, particularly relating to regular languages.

Pedagogical Tools: Each chapter features solved examples, flowcharts, and objective questions graded according to Bloom's Taxonomy.

Exam Preparation: Includes five model question papers to assist with university examinations. Community & Expert Reviews

Reviews for the book on platforms like Amazon and Goodreads highlight a mix of perspectives: Theory of Computation : Kulkarni, Vivek: Amazon.de: Books

While I can’t provide a direct PDF download link for copyrighted material like Vivek Kulkarni’s Theory of Computation, I can certainly help you understand why this specific textbook is so highly regarded and give you a comprehensive overview of the core concepts it covers.

If you are a computer science student or an aspiring engineer, this guide will help you navigate the essential "Theory of Computation" (ToC) landscape. Understanding Theory of Computation by Vivek Kulkarni

Theory of Computation is the backbone of computer science. It deals with the fundamental capabilities and limitations of computers. Vivek Kulkarni’s approach is popular among students because it simplifies abstract mathematical concepts into digestible logic, often used to prepare for university exams and competitive tests like GATE. Why Study Theory of Computation?

Before searching for a "Theory of Computation by Vivek Kulkarni PDF," it’s important to understand what the subject offers:

Algorithm Design: Helps in understanding which problems can be solved efficiently.

Compiler Construction: ToC provides the logic behind how programming languages are parsed. Navigating the Theory of Computation with Vivek Kulkarni

Complexity Theory: It teaches you how to measure the "hardness" of a problem (P vs NP). Key Topics Covered in the Book 1. Finite Automata (FA)

This is the simplest model of computation. Kulkarni explains Deterministic Finite Automata (DFA) and Non-deterministic Finite Automata (NFA) through clear state diagrams. These are used in text processing, compilers, and hardware design. 2. Regular Languages and Grammar

You’ll learn about Regular Expressions (RE) and how they relate to Finite Automata. The book typically covers Kleene’s Theorem and the Pumping Lemma, which is a crucial tool used to prove that a language is not regular. 3. Context-Free Grammars (CFG) and Languages (CFL)

Most programming languages are defined using CFGs. Kulkarni’s text walks you through Pushdown Automata (PDA)—basically a finite automaton with a "stack" for memory—which is necessary to recognize context-free languages. 4. Turing Machines (TM)

The Turing Machine is the ultimate model of a general-purpose computer. The book explores the Church-Turing Thesis, explaining that anything that can be computed by an algorithm can be computed by a Turing Machine. 5. Decidability and Complexity

This advanced section covers "Undecidability" (the Halting Problem) and Computational Complexity. It helps students understand why some problems are impossible for computers to solve, regardless of how much processing power they have. Features of Vivek Kulkarni’s Approach

Step-by-Step Solved Examples: ToC is math-heavy; this book provides numerous solved problems to help students master the "mapping" of logic.

Simple Language: Unlike more dense academic texts (like Sipser or Hopcroft), Kulkarni uses a more conversational and student-friendly tone.

Exam Oriented: The structure is tailored for those looking to score well in technical interviews and academic examinations. How to Access the Material Legally

If you are looking for a "free download," consider these legal and more sustainable alternatives to pirated PDFs:

University Libraries: Most CS departments carry physical or digital copies of Kulkarni’s work accessible via student portals.

Google Books/Publisher Previews: You can often view significant portions of the book for free to see if it fits your learning style.

Rentals: Platforms like Amazon or local bookstores often offer low-cost digital rentals.

Open Source Alternatives: If you need the concepts rather than the specific book, NPTEL (India) and MIT OpenCourseWare offer world-class video lectures and notes on Theory of Computation for free. Final Thoughts

Theory of Computation is not just a subject to pass; it is a way of thinking that defines what it means to be a Computer Scientist. While Vivek Kulkarni’s book is an excellent resource, the best way to learn is by practicing the construction of Automata and Turing Machines yourself.

I understand you're looking for content related to the keyword "Theory Of Computation By Vivek Kulkarni Pdf Free Download". However, I must first address an important ethical and legal point before writing the article.

Please note: I cannot promote or facilitate copyright infringement by providing direct links to or encouraging unauthorized free downloads of copyrighted textbooks. "Theory of Computation" by Vivek Kulkarni is a copyrighted work, and downloading it without payment (unless the author or publisher has explicitly released it for free) violates intellectual property laws.

Instead, I will write a detailed, SEO-friendly article that:

  1. Highlights the value of the book.
  2. Explains legitimate ways to access it (library, purchase, institutional access, etc.).
  3. Suggests legal free alternatives and open-source resources for learning Theory of Computation (TOC).
  4. Answers common student queries about the subject and the book.

Here is the long-form article you requested, optimized for the keyword but compliant with ethical guidelines.


3. Solve Every Solved Example

Cover the solution and try yourself. His examples on Pumping Lemma are particularly helpful.

The Digital Demand

The inclusion of "Pdf Free Download" in the search query speaks to the economic and practical realities of the modern student. While the physical book is available in bookstores, the demand for a PDF version is driven by several factors: Check your university or public library catalog for

  1. Accessibility: Students want instant access to the material on their laptops or tablets for late-night study sessions.
  2. Cost: Textbooks can be expensive, and students often look for free digital versions to bypass the cost barrier.
  3. Searchability: A digital PDF allows students to quickly Ctrl+F specific theorems or definitions, a crucial feature during revision.

Legal Ways to Access Theory of Computation by Vivek Kulkarni

1. "Introduction to the Theory of Computation" (Michael Sipser) – Authorized free draft

Q3: Is the Vivek Kulkarni book enough for GATE CS preparation?

A: Partially. For GATE, you need deeper problem-solving ability. Use Kulkarni for basic concepts, but supplement with standard problems from GATE Previous Year Books (e.g., by Made Easy or ACE Academy). Also read "Introduction to Automata Theory" by Hopcroft, Motwani & Ullman (free library copies available).